South Carolina EIN for Non-US Business Owners: Key Information

As a non-US business owner, it can be challenging to navigate the legal requirements of doing business in South Carolina. One critical aspect of running a successful business in this state is obtaining an Employer Identification Number (EIN).

An EIN is a unique nine-digit number assigned by the Internal Revenue Service (IRS) that identifies your business for tax purposes. Understanding the purpose and importance of an EIN is crucial before beginning the application process. Your EIN serves as your business’s identification number, similar to how your Social Security number identifies you as an individual.

You will need this number to open a bank account, file taxes, hire employees or contractors, and more. Furthermore, some vendors or clients may require you to have an EIN before working with them. By obtaining an EIN as a non-US business owner operating in South Carolina, you are demonstrating compliance with US tax laws and building credibility with potential partners or customers.

In this article, we will provide key information on South Carolina EIN for non-US business owners and guide you through the process of applying for one.

Additionally, for non-US business owners looking to establish their presence in South Carolina, it’s essential to understand the process of registering an LLC. Knowing how to register LLC in south carolina ensures compliance with local regulations and provides a solid foundation for your ventures in this dynamic state.

If you’re a non-US business owner looking to obtain a South Carolina EIN, finding reliable assistance to navigate through the process is crucial. That’s where the best south carolina LLC services for self-employed individuals come into play, ensuring a smooth experience while obtaining your EIN.

One crucial aspect for foreign entities doing business in South Carolina is obtaining a South Carolina EIN. This identification number is necessary for tax purposes and helps streamline their operations within the state.

Foreign business owners looking to establish a presence in South Carolina must navigate the process of obtaining a South Carolina EIN, also known as an Employer Identification Number. This unique identifier allows these entities to comply with state regulations, ensuring smooth operations for their South Carolina ventures.

For foreign business owners operating in South Carolina, obtaining a South Carolina EIN for their entity is an essential step to ensure compliance with local regulations and establish a solid foundation for their operations.

Check Out These Related Posts – Nevada LLC Services: A 2023 Expert Analysis

Understanding the Purpose of an EIN

Understanding the purpose of an EIN is crucial for non-US business owners. It allows them to conduct business and establish legal status in the United States. An EIN is a nine-digit number assigned by the IRS to identify businesses for tax purposes. The EIN serves as a unique identifier for your business, which you will use when filing taxes, opening bank accounts, applying for credit and loans, and even hiring employees.

Non-US citizens who own businesses in the US are eligible to apply for an EIN. This includes sole proprietors and LLCs. The application process is straightforward and can be done online through the IRS website or by mail. Once approved, non-US business owners can enjoy several benefits such as establishing credibility with clients, suppliers, and financial institutions.

There are taxation implications associated with having an EIN that non-US business owners should be aware of. Non-resident aliens who do not have an SSN may need to obtain an ITIN before they can apply for an EIN. It’s important to note that there are alternatives available if you’re not eligible or don’t want to obtain an EIN. For instance, if you’re a sole proprietor without employees or don’t plan on hiring employees anytime soon, you can use your SSN instead of obtaining an EIN.

Understanding these nuances will help non-US business owners make informed decisions about their legal status in South Carolina.

In order to conduct business legally in South Carolina as a non-US citizen or foreign entity owner, one must first apply for an EIN from the IRS. Now that we understand what an EIN is and why it’s important for non-US citizens conducting business in South Carolina, let’s dive into how to apply for this critical identification number.

Keep Reading – New Hampshire LLC Services: A 2023 Expert Analysis

Applying for an EIN in South Carolina

To get an EIN in SC, you’ll need to fill out a Form SS-4 with the IRS. However, before applying for this identification number, it’s important to understand whether non-US business owners are eligible for an EIN in South Carolina. The good news is that foreign entities can apply for an EIN as long as they have a valid reason, such as conducting business or opening a bank account in the US.

When applying for an EIN in South Carolina, it’s important to note that processing times vary depending on the method used. The quickest way to obtain an EIN is by applying online through the IRS website, which typically takes only a few minutes. Alternatively, paper applications can be mailed or faxed to the appropriate office and generally take up to four weeks to process.

To expedite your application process and ensure that all necessary information is included on your application form, it’s important to know what required information is needed before submitting your request for an EIN. This includes details such as your business name and address, responsible party information (such as social security number or ITIN), and a brief description of the nature of your organization. By providing accurate and complete information upfront, you can help speed up the processing time and avoid any potential delays or complications down the road.

Recommended Reading – New Jersey LLC Services: A 2023 Expert Analysis

Required Information for EIN Application

Make sure you’ve got all the necessary details ready when applying for an EIN, as providing accurate and complete information upfront can help speed up the processing time and avoid any potential delays or complications in the future.

The application process for obtaining an EIN in South Carolina is relatively straightforward, but it requires specific documentation requirements. You’ll need to provide your business name, mailing address, legal structure, and other relevant information.

To apply for an EIN in South Carolina, you must have a valid Taxpayer Identification Number (TIN), issued by the Internal Revenue Service (IRS), which is used to identify your business for tax purposes. Additionally, you’ll need to provide documentation that proves your identity and legal status as a non-US business owner. This may include a passport or other government-issued identification document.

In addition to these basic requirements, there may be additional considerations depending on your specific situation. For example, if you’re operating as a sole proprietorship or partnership without employees, you may not need an EIN at all. However, if you plan to hire employees or establish a separate legal entity such as a corporation or LLC in the future, it’s important to obtain an EIN early on in the process.

With these considerations in mind, let’s explore some additional factors that can impact your ability to obtain an EIN in South Carolina.

Additional Considerations

You’ll want to keep in mind some important factors that could affect your ability to quickly obtain an EIN for your company. These additional considerations are critical to ensure you avoid any legal implications and foreign taxation issues that may arise.

Here are four things to consider before applying for a South Carolina EIN as a non-US business owner:

  1. Foreign taxation: As a non-US business owner, it’s essential to understand the foreign tax laws and regulations that apply within your country of origin. This includes understanding how taxes will be calculated and paid on any income generated from your South Carolina-based operations.
  2. Legal implications: It’s crucial to have an in-depth understanding of the legal implications associated with operating a business outside of your home country. This includes understanding the various compliance requirements, such as annual filings, reporting obligations, and other regulatory requirements.
  3. Timing considerations: The time frame for obtaining an EIN can vary depending on several factors such as completeness of application, level of detail provided in supporting documents, and current processing times at the IRS.
  4. Language barriers: Non-native English speakers may find it challenging to navigate through the application process due to language barriers or differences in terminology between their native language and English.

It’s essential to keep these additional considerations in mind when applying for an EIN as a non-US business owner in South Carolina. Once you’ve obtained your EIN number, it’s vital that you know how to maintain it properly – which we’ll discuss further in the next section about ‘maintaining your ein.’

Maintaining Your EIN

Maintaining your EIN is crucial for the long-term success of your business. Your EIN represents your business identity and serves as a unique identifier for tax purposes. Renewing your EIN on time is essential to ensure that you continue to enjoy the benefits of having an active EIN, such as opening bank accounts or obtaining credit cards.

The renewing process for an EIN is straightforward. You need to update your information with the IRS every year by filing a tax return or providing a written statement confirming that there were no changes in your business operations. The renewal process typically takes less than 30 minutes, and it’s free of charge. However, failing to renew your EIN can have serious consequences.

If you fail to renew your EIN, it will become inactive after two years of inactivity. An inactive EIN does not necessarily mean that you lose the rights associated with having an EIN, but it can create additional hurdles when trying to access financial services or conduct transactions with other businesses. Additionally, if you don’t renew your EIN before losing its active status, you might need to apply for a new one altogether and start from scratch again, which can be time-consuming and costly. Therefore, make sure you keep track of when it’s time to renew and avoid any unwanted drawbacks down the line.

Consequences Renewal Process
Inactive status Update information annually through tax return or written statement
Difficulty accessing financial services Free of charge
Needing to apply for a new one Takes less than 30 minutes

Maintaining an active South Carolina Ein should be on top of every non-US business owner’s priority list since it serves as their unique identifier for tax purposes and provides them access to various financial services necessary in conducting day-to-day operations. Ensure that you follow the renewal process every year without fail to avoid any unwanted consequences such as inactivity, difficulty accessing financial services, or the need to apply for a new one. With this knowledge in mind, you can rest assured that your business operations are running efficiently and effectively.

Keep Reading – Nebraska LLC Services: A 2023 Expert Analysis

Conclusion

In conclusion, obtaining an EIN in South Carolina as a non-US business owner is crucial for conducting business operations in the state. It serves as a unique identifier for tax purposes and ensures compliance with federal and state regulations.

The application process can easily be completed online through the IRS website, but it’s important to have all necessary information on hand before beginning. It’s also essential to maintain your EIN by keeping accurate records and promptly updating any changes to your business information.

Failure to do so can result in penalties or even revocation of your EIN. By following these steps and staying informed about the requirements and regulations surrounding an EIN, you can ensure that your non-US business is able to operate smoothly in South Carolina.

LLCMark is the go-to website for all things LLC-related, providing valuable insights and resources for entrepreneurs. Starting an LLC has never been easier with LLCMark’s comprehensive guides and expert advice.

Leave a Comment